At tilføje en e-mail som et link er en almindelig praksis i webudvikling, så besøgende på hjemmesiden nemt kan sende e-mails ved at klikke på en specificeret e-mailadresse. Denne funktion er især nyttig til kontaktformularer, e-mail-abonnementer og kommunikationsformål. I denne artikel vil vi udforske processen med at tilføje en e-mail som et link, diskutere de nødvendige HTML-tags og give indsigt i bedste praksis.
1. Forståelse af mailto:-protokollen:
For at tilføje en e-mail som et link bruges „mailto:‟-protokollen. Denne protokol gør det muligt for browseren at åbne brugerens standard e-mailklient med en ny besked og udfylde modtagerens e-mailadresse på forhånd. Ved at bruge „mailto:‟-protokollen kan du problemfrit integrere e-mailfunktionalitet på din hjemmeside.
2. Syntaks for mailto: Link:
Syntaksen for at oprette et mailto: link er som følger:
<a href=“mailto:recipient@example.com“>Email Me</a>
I dette eksempel skal „recipient@example.com‟ erstattes med den ønskede e-mailadresse. Linkteksten, „Email Me‟, kan også tilpasses efter dine præferencer.
3. Tilføjelse af yderligere parametre:
Ud over modtagerens e-mailadresse kan du inkludere yderligere parametre i mailto:-linket for at forbedre brugeroplevelsen. Disse parametre omfatter:
a) Emnelinje:
Hvis du vil angive en emnelinje for e-mailen, kan du tilføje parameteren „subject‟ til mailto: linket. For eksempel:
<a href=“mailto:recipient@example.com?subject=Regarding%20Your%20Inquiry“>Email Me</a>
Here, the subject parameter is set to “Regarding Your Inquiry.” Note that spaces are represented by “%20” in URLs.
b) Indhold i brødteksten:
Hvis du vil udfylde e-mailens brødtekst på forhånd, kan du bruge parameteren „body‟. For eksempel:
<a href=“mailto:recipient@example.com?body=Hello,%20I%20would%20like%20to%20discuss%20further.“>Email Me</a>
I dette tilfælde er body-parameteren indstillet til „Hello, I would like to discuss further.‟
c) Flere modtagere:
Hvis du vil tilføje flere modtagere, skal du adskille e-mailadresserne med kommaer, som vist nedenfor:
<a href=“mailto:recipient1@example.com,recipient2@example.com“>Email Us</a>
4. Overvejelser om styling og tilgængelighed:
Når man tilføjer e-mail-links, er det vigtigt at tænke på tilgængelighed og sikre, at de visuelt kan skelnes fra almindelig tekst. Anvendelse af passende CSS-stilarter, såsom understregning eller farveændringer, kan hjælpe brugerne med at identificere linket som en e-mailadresse.
5. Bedste praksis:
For at optimere brugeroplevelsen og undgå potentielle problemer skal du huske på følgende best practices:
a) Brug tydelig og kortfattet linktekst:
Sørg for, at linkteksten tydeligt angiver, at det er et e-mail-link. I stedet for generiske sætninger som „Klik